본문 바로가기

Domain/시스템 프로그래밍

9. Assembler

32bit CPU에서 Assembler

 

Machine code

 

기계어에서 어셈블리 언어로의 변환

 

 

 

Assembler의 구조

 

64bit CPU에서 Assembler

새로운 레지스터의 encode64bit addressing이 필요하고, 이전 것들과의 호환성이 유지되어야 하는 문제를 해결해야 한다.

 

64bit Machine Code

 

 

Inline Assembly 

 High level language에 내장된 어셈블리 언어 

 

'Domain > 시스템 프로그래밍' 카테고리의 다른 글

4. Process Structure  (0) 2020.03.14
5. Task Programming  (0) 2020.03.14
6. IA Assembly Programming  (0) 2020.03.14
7. IA : History & Features  (0) 2020.03.14
8. Optimization  (0) 2020.03.14